Self-Programming

In the early years of the 21st century, car key technology began to shift away from traditional mechanical keys to a hybrid of electronic and physical protocols to prevent theft. The majority of these keys have a microchip integrated within them that must be programmed to link them to your vehicle's electronic system. Professional locksmiths with the right equipment can reprogram your keys. Many vehicles, particularly luxury cars, only allow the dealer to create new keys.

The method for doing this on your own The method for doing this varies from manufacturer to manufacturer. It typically involves inserting the spare key for the working car into the ignition, and manipulating it (in conformity with the directions in the owner's manual) until your car enters programming mode. It is necessary to move fast to complete the procedure, since it only lasts just a few seconds until your car is out of the mode.

Once your vehicle is in programming mode, you'll need to repeat the process for each key that you'd like to program. The owner's manual should contain specific instructions for the model and key type that you want to program. Some models have extra security features that must be turned on.

Certain models of cars require an additional code that can only be obtained through the dealership for a fee to you. This code protects you from "skimming" which is when a thief attempts to read the information of your key through the OBD2 port to start the car and then steal it.

Key Programmers

If you've lost your car key cut and program near me keys or in the event that you're replacing them you might wonder whether it's possible to reprogramme car key the key. It's contingent on the manufacturer, but most vehicles require that you work with a dealer or auto locksmith to have the new key inserted into the vehicle's system. This involves reprogramming of the transponder in the new key to match the initial settings of your car.

Certain cars let you do it yourself, but most require a professional dealer to utilize a tool that is able to connect to the vehicle and read the programming information from the ECU. The key is then reprogrammed to match the car's setting and you can use it as a normal key.

There are many different types of car key programmers. Some use specific brands and models of cars some are more universal and can be used on a wide variety of vehicles. Most of them have a tiny screen and a few buttons you press to enter the programming mode. You can plug the device into an OBD-II connector to read and program the new key.

It takes only a few minutes for a professional to program a new key for the majority of vehicles, however some cars take longer and require complicated procedures to reprogram the keys correctly. For instance, certain modern vehicles require a special code that only the car dealer is able to access and use to access the immobilizer's systems. In these situations, it's best to leave the job to a professional so that you don't cause damage to the system and then have no means to start your car.

Key Fobs

Modern day key fobs provide numerous convenience and security benefits. They can replace or enhance traditional keys for cars and be used to control more than just locking doors; they can start the engine, trigger the alarm and perform other functions.

The key fob key programmer communicates with the receiver in the vehicle via radio signals. When you press a button on the key fob, it transmits an encoded code to the receiver, which then responds by performing the function you want. Key fobs are also very popular with commercial building owners who can incorporate them into the larger access control system. This lets them keep track of who enters and exits and block fobs that have been stolen or lost.

Key fobs, just like any electronic device, could malfunction. Because they are constantly tossed around in pockets and purses they may get damaged or lose their signal. While they can take some abuse however, they're not impervious to damage. In the end, they are made from plastic and metal.

If your key fobs are not functioning, you may need to replace the battery. Make sure you use the correct battery and refer to the owner's manual to learn how to replace it properly. Also, be sure to follow any additional steps to reprogramming or recalibration that might apply.

Simple wear and tear is a common cause of failing fobs. They may break or break when they are dropped, bumped into objects, and jostled around in pockets and purses. A simple and cheap fix can often be all you need to get your keyfobs working again.

Keyless Entry

Keyless entry is a feature that lets you unlock and start your car without needing to insert a physical key. It uses wireless signals to connect with the car's system inside, and it also lets you to control various features in the car, such as climate controls or music systems.

Modern keyless entry systems employ rolling code technology to guard against hacking and other security breaches. However it is important to keep in mind that even this technology has its limitations. A burglar could employ a technique referred to as "replay attack" to send a message that is recorded by the car's receiver. After the message is recorded, a malicious device can retransmit this transmission to the car's receiver in order to gain access.

Depending on the make and model of your vehicle, you might be capable of programming new keys on your own or engage an automotive locksmith do it. Certain car manufacturers offer an onboard program specifically designed for them for their vehicles, while others require you have an advanced programer connected to the OBD2 connector.

The most commonly used method of programming new keys for cars is to insert the fob of the key in the ignition and engage it in a certain order. This puts the car into the "programming mode," and once it is, one or more fob buttons will be pressed to transmit the digital identity code to the car's computer. The computer then saves the code and removes the car from programming mode.

Certain manufacturers require you to have an advanced computer to program key fobs, and some of them are expensive and difficult to use by a typical person. It is best to leave the task to an Auto Locksmith key programming locksmith or dealer.
